NDIS and Your Rights: Self-Advocacy and Eligibility Reassessments Information Session

Event description

Join CYDA for a free online information session on NDIS eligibility reassessments.
We’ll share the latest results from CYDA’s survey, hear from community leaders and legal experts, and provide practical advice for families, young people and advocates.

Why attend?

  • Understand the impact of eligibility reassessments on children and young people with disability

  • Hear directly about the experiences of Autistic and First Nations children and families

  • Learn about your rights, reviews, and appeal options from a disability rights lawyer

  • Get practical tips for self-advocacy and support

  • Find out what’s next for eligibility reassessments and NDIS reforms

Who is this event for?

  • Parents and caregivers of children and young people with disability

  • Young people with disability

  • Advocates, sector representatives, and supporters

Accessibility

This session will be:

  • Auslan interpreted

  • Live captioned

  • Recorded (with captions and Auslan) and shared on CYDA's YouTube channel after the event.
